[OOM] Fixing k8s cpu limits
Adding specific cpu limits for all oom components
Issue-ID: OOM-3241
Change-Id: I0bbd973d91d11dbb0ffa5848f7c1ed5ebb5f54ba
Signed-off-by: vladimir turok <vladimir.turok@t-systems.com>
diff --git a/kubernetes/so/components/so-admin-cockpit/values.yaml b/kubernetes/so/components/so-admin-cockpit/values.yaml
index 32074d9..2b05dbe 100644
--- a/kubernetes/so/components/so-admin-cockpit/values.yaml
+++ b/kubernetes/so/components/so-admin-cockpit/values.yaml
@@ -114,14 +114,14 @@
cpu: 0.25
limits:
memory: 4Gi
- cpu: 999
+ cpu: 0.5
large:
requests:
memory: 2Gi
cpu: 0.5
limits:
memory: 8Gi
- cpu: 999
+ cpu: 1
unlimited: {}
readinessProbe:
port: 9091
diff --git a/kubernetes/so/components/so-bpmn-infra/values.yaml b/kubernetes/so/components/so-bpmn-infra/values.yaml
index 0d5a0c4..80d5b67 100755
--- a/kubernetes/so/components/so-bpmn-infra/values.yaml
+++ b/kubernetes/so/components/so-bpmn-infra/values.yaml
@@ -136,14 +136,14 @@
small:
limits:
memory: 3Gi
- cpu: 999
+ cpu: 1
requests:
memory: 3Gi
cpu: 0.5
large:
limits:
memory: 6Gi
- cpu: 999
+ cpu: 2
requests:
memory: 6Gi
cpu: 1
diff --git a/kubernetes/so/components/so-catalog-db-adapter/values.yaml b/kubernetes/so/components/so-catalog-db-adapter/values.yaml
index 23a3b69..619ef03 100755
--- a/kubernetes/so/components/so-catalog-db-adapter/values.yaml
+++ b/kubernetes/so/components/so-catalog-db-adapter/values.yaml
@@ -100,14 +100,14 @@
small:
limits:
memory: 1.5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1.5Gi
cpu: 0.5
large:
limits:
memory: 3Gi
- cpu: 999
+ cpu: 2
requests:
memory: 3Gi
cpu: 1
diff --git a/kubernetes/so/components/so-cnf-adapter/values.yaml b/kubernetes/so/components/so-cnf-adapter/values.yaml
index 09e631a..3855c19 100755
--- a/kubernetes/so/components/so-cnf-adapter/values.yaml
+++ b/kubernetes/so/components/so-cnf-adapter/values.yaml
@@ -122,14 +122,14 @@
small:
limits:
memory: 1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1Gi
cpu: 0.5
large:
limits:
memory: 2Gi
- cpu: 999
+ cpu: 2
requests:
memory: 2Gi
cpu: 1
diff --git a/kubernetes/so/components/so-etsi-nfvo-ns-lcm/values.yaml b/kubernetes/so/components/so-etsi-nfvo-ns-lcm/values.yaml
index 32171ba..2084bef 100644
--- a/kubernetes/so/components/so-etsi-nfvo-ns-lcm/values.yaml
+++ b/kubernetes/so/components/so-etsi-nfvo-ns-lcm/values.yaml
@@ -113,17 +113,17 @@
small:
limits:
memory: 1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1Gi
cpu: 0.5
large:
limits:
memory: 5Gi
- cpu: 999
+ cpu: 2
requests:
memory: 2Gi
- cpu: 4
+ cpu: 1
unlimited: {}
livenessProbe:
diff --git a/kubernetes/so/components/so-etsi-sol003-adapter/values.yaml b/kubernetes/so/components/so-etsi-sol003-adapter/values.yaml
index 0c02cb2..ca4e787 100755
--- a/kubernetes/so/components/so-etsi-sol003-adapter/values.yaml
+++ b/kubernetes/so/components/so-etsi-sol003-adapter/values.yaml
@@ -87,14 +87,14 @@
small:
limits:
memory: 1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1Gi
cpu: 0.5
large:
limits:
memory: 2Gi
- cpu: 999
+ cpu: 2
requests:
memory: 2Gi
cpu: 1
diff --git a/kubernetes/so/components/so-etsi-sol005-adapter/values.yaml b/kubernetes/so/components/so-etsi-sol005-adapter/values.yaml
index e2816b0..f565eb0 100755
--- a/kubernetes/so/components/so-etsi-sol005-adapter/values.yaml
+++ b/kubernetes/so/components/so-etsi-sol005-adapter/values.yaml
@@ -96,14 +96,14 @@
small:
limits:
memory: 1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1Gi
cpu: 0.5
large:
limits:
memory: 2Gi
- cpu: 999
+ cpu: 2
requests:
memory: 2Gi
cpu: 1
diff --git a/kubernetes/so/components/so-nssmf-adapter/values.yaml b/kubernetes/so/components/so-nssmf-adapter/values.yaml
index c6a6f35..8e83734 100755
--- a/kubernetes/so/components/so-nssmf-adapter/values.yaml
+++ b/kubernetes/so/components/so-nssmf-adapter/values.yaml
@@ -121,14 +121,14 @@
small:
limits:
memory: 1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1Gi
cpu: 0.5
large:
limits:
memory: 2Gi
- cpu: 999
+ cpu: 2
requests:
memory: 2Gi
cpu: 1
diff --git a/kubernetes/so/components/so-oof-adapter/values.yaml b/kubernetes/so/components/so-oof-adapter/values.yaml
index 24a171c..3ce43c6 100755
--- a/kubernetes/so/components/so-oof-adapter/values.yaml
+++ b/kubernetes/so/components/so-oof-adapter/values.yaml
@@ -103,14 +103,14 @@
small:
limits:
memory: 1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1Gi
cpu: 0.5
large:
limits:
memory: 2Gi
- cpu: 999
+ cpu: 2
requests:
memory: 2Gi
cpu: 1
diff --git a/kubernetes/so/components/so-openstack-adapter/values.yaml b/kubernetes/so/components/so-openstack-adapter/values.yaml
index 3258f8f..3b68a36 100755
--- a/kubernetes/so/components/so-openstack-adapter/values.yaml
+++ b/kubernetes/so/components/so-openstack-adapter/values.yaml
@@ -105,14 +105,14 @@
small:
limits:
memory: 1.5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1.5Gi
cpu: 0.5
large:
limits:
memory: 3Gi
- cpu: 999
+ cpu: 2
requests:
memory: 3Gi
cpu: 1
diff --git a/kubernetes/so/components/so-request-db-adapter/values.yaml b/kubernetes/so/components/so-request-db-adapter/values.yaml
index 0ec56c0..5f02a85 100755
--- a/kubernetes/so/components/so-request-db-adapter/values.yaml
+++ b/kubernetes/so/components/so-request-db-adapter/values.yaml
@@ -96,14 +96,14 @@
small:
limits:
memory: 1.5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1.5Gi
cpu: 0.5
large:
limits:
memory: 3Gi
- cpu: 999
+ cpu: 2
requests:
memory: 3Gi
cpu: 1
diff --git a/kubernetes/so/components/so-sdc-controller/values.yaml b/kubernetes/so/components/so-sdc-controller/values.yaml
index eea19df..77b94dd 100755
--- a/kubernetes/so/components/so-sdc-controller/values.yaml
+++ b/kubernetes/so/components/so-sdc-controller/values.yaml
@@ -107,14 +107,14 @@
small:
limits:
memory: 1.5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1.5Gi
cpu: 0.5
large:
limits:
memory: 3Gi
- cpu: 999
+ cpu: 2
requests:
memory: 3Gi
cpu: 1
diff --git a/kubernetes/so/components/so-sdnc-adapter/values.yaml b/kubernetes/so/components/so-sdnc-adapter/values.yaml
index 1f0a18d..9542ab8 100755
--- a/kubernetes/so/components/so-sdnc-adapter/values.yaml
+++ b/kubernetes/so/components/so-sdnc-adapter/values.yaml
@@ -116,14 +116,14 @@
small:
limits:
memory: 1.5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1.5Gi
cpu: 0.5
large:
limits:
memory: 3Gi
- cpu: 999
+ cpu: 2
requests:
memory: 3Gi
cpu: 1
diff --git a/kubernetes/so/components/so-ve-vnfm-adapter/values.yaml b/kubernetes/so/components/so-ve-vnfm-adapter/values.yaml
index e1d211c..183e7f6 100755
--- a/kubernetes/so/components/so-ve-vnfm-adapter/values.yaml
+++ b/kubernetes/so/components/so-ve-vnfm-adapter/values.yaml
@@ -53,14 +53,14 @@
small:
limits:
memory: 1Gi
- cpu: 999
+ cpu: 1
requests:
memory: 1Gi
cpu: 0.5
large:
limits:
memory: 2Gi
- cpu: 999
+ cpu: 2
requests:
memory: 2Gi
cpu: 1
diff --git a/kubernetes/so/values.yaml b/kubernetes/so/values.yaml
index bf412e8..81cd1d9 100755
--- a/kubernetes/so/values.yaml
+++ b/kubernetes/so/values.yaml
@@ -549,14 +549,14 @@
resources:
small:
limits:
- cpu: 999
+ cpu: 1
memory: 4Gi
requests:
cpu: 0.5
memory: 1Gi
large:
limits:
- cpu: 999
+ cpu: 2
memory: 8Gi
requests:
cpu: 1